Abstract

[Problem] To correct a gray level so as to satisfy both a halo and a retinex operation effect. [Solution] A corresponding JND value is obtained for a brightness value in an obtained panel unit gray level. A pixel value corresponding to the JND value is obtained for each panel unit gray level (fig. 3B). A threshold (e) is obtained from an identifiable JND value for each panel unit gray level by inverse gamma correcting the ratio of said JND values to the maximum output value of the panel (fig. 3C). An approximate result from a linear function is calculated using the method of least squares (fig. 3D). The threshold (e) is identified as an increasing function of the pixel value on the basis of the number of allowable JND steps. The threshold (e) is changed using such a function. Hence it is possible to vary the threshold (e) according to a center pixel value.
